1. Understand the Medical Tourism Landscape
Before taking your first step, conduct comprehensive research into the global medical tourism ecosystem. Identify the top-performing destinations such as Thailand, India, Turkey, and Mexico, and analyze the treatments drawing the most interest—cosmetic procedures, fertility treatments, orthopedic surgeries, and dental care often top the list. Examine patient demographics, motivations, and expectations. This research will help you tailor your services to meet real market needs.
2. Forge Strong Partnerships with Healthcare Providers
Your credibility in this business depends on your partnerships. Collaborate with internationally accredited hospitals, specialized clinics, and certified physicians known for their quality of care. Confirm that your partners adhere to global healthcare standards and provide transparent data on their credentials, success rates, and patient reviews. Establishing long-term agreements with these institutions not only ensures reliability but also helps you offer competitive pricing—building trust with your clientele.
3. Prioritize the Patient Journey
In medical tourism, your clients are not typical travelers—they are patients seeking treatment during vulnerable moments. To earn their trust, focus on a seamless and compassionate experience. Offer customized care packages that combine treatment, travel, and recovery support. Be transparent about pricing, procedures, and recovery times. Provide full-service assistance with flights, lodging, and local transport, and maintain post-treatment follow-up once they return home.

6. Maintain Legal and Ethical Standards
The medical tourism industry operates under strict legal and ethical frameworks. Ensure your business complies with international healthcare regulations, patient data protection laws, visa and travel policies, and medical insurance standards. Transparency about costs, risks, and responsibilities will enhance your reputation and help you build long-term trust with clients and partners.
7. Stand Out with Distinctive Offerings
Competition in healthcare tourism is growing rapidly. Differentiate your company by introducing value-added services like wellness recovery packages, medical visa assistance, insurance facilitation, or multilingual support. Consider concierge-style care for patients and accompanying family members. Small touches like these can elevate your brand and set you apart as a premium service provider.
